Numbers 30:3-12 God's Word Translation (GW)

3. “A young girl, who still lives in her father’s house, might make a vow to the Lord that she will do something or swear an oath that she won’t do something.

4. If her father says nothing to her when he hears about it, her vow or oath must be kept.

5. But if her father objects when he hears about it, her vow or oath doesn’t have to be kept. The Lord will free her ⌊from this vow or oath⌋ because her father objected.

6. “An unmarried woman might make a vow that she will do something or carelessly promise that she won’t do something. When she marries,

7. her husband may hear about it but say nothing to her. Then her vow or oath must be kept.

8. But if her husband objects when he hears about it, he can cancel the vow or promise she made. The Lord will free her ⌊from this vow or promise⌋.

9. “But a widow or a divorced woman must keep her vow or her promise.

10. “A married woman might make a vow that she will do something or swear an oath that she won’t do something.

11. Her husband may hear about it but may say nothing and not object. Then her vow or oath must be kept.

12. But if her husband cancels it when he hears about it, nothing she said in her vow or oath has to be kept. Her husband has canceled it, and the Lord will free her ⌊from this vow or oath⌋.
